Plynulý pohyb

RaS
Příspěvky: 8590
Registrován: 26. 3. 2009, 9:12
Bydliště: Úvaly

8. 11. 2014, 8:49

jsem to přečetl 3x a stejně nevím co chceš.. :D
napiš to souřadnicema.. jako že chceš začít třeba na X 0 v Z-2,5mm a chceš se dostat do bodu X30 a Z25?? to přece není problém nebo jsem to nepochopil..
věčný rýpal,který musí mít poslední slovo, odpůrce low-cost zařízení končících v naprosté většině případů v hromadě šrotu
uživatelé hýbátek, kteří mají z mých příspěvků celoživotní trauma nechť si mé příspěvky VYPNOU
Uživatelský avatar
robokop
Site Admin
Příspěvky: 22954
Registrován: 10. 7. 2006, 12:12
Bydliště: Praha
Kontaktovat uživatele:

8. 11. 2014, 8:51

pro nekoho to problem muze byt
Vsechna prava na chyby vyhrazena (E)
Uživatelský avatar
robokop
Site Admin
Příspěvky: 22954
Registrován: 10. 7. 2006, 12:12
Bydliště: Praha
Kontaktovat uživatele:

8. 11. 2014, 9:05

dej sem vypis toho programu
Vsechna prava na chyby vyhrazena (E)
RaS
Příspěvky: 8590
Registrován: 26. 3. 2009, 9:12
Bydliště: Úvaly

8. 11. 2014, 9:32

jenže tenhle program ať dáš do machu nebo do emc nebo kamkoliv jinam tak pojede pořád stejně.. vždyť je tam jasně nadefinovaný co má dělat.. zajede kolmo do Y-1,25 objede v XY pak zase skočí do Z-2,5 a objede zase něco v XY a pak vyjede v Zku.. to máš prostě blbě napsanej program a nemůžeš po něm chtít něco co v něm není..
v čem je to napsaný?
věčný rýpal,který musí mít poslední slovo, odpůrce low-cost zařízení končících v naprosté většině případů v hromadě šrotu
uživatelé hýbátek, kteří mají z mých příspěvků celoživotní trauma nechť si mé příspěvky VYPNOU
RaS
Příspěvky: 8590
Registrován: 26. 3. 2009, 9:12
Bydliště: Úvaly

8. 11. 2014, 9:46

já aspire neznám.. ale podle mě to máš zadaný jako 2D ve dvou hloubkách, tak po něm nemůžeš chtít aby jezdil ve 3D, resp pokud chceš aby jezdil 3D musíš to tak mít naprogramovaný..
věčný rýpal,který musí mít poslední slovo, odpůrce low-cost zařízení končících v naprosté většině případů v hromadě šrotu
uživatelé hýbátek, kteří mají z mých příspěvků celoživotní trauma nechť si mé příspěvky VYPNOU
RaS
Příspěvky: 8590
Registrován: 26. 3. 2009, 9:12
Bydliště: Úvaly

8. 11. 2014, 10:27

já se ti snažím vysvětlit že to není emcčkem ani machem že je to špatně napsaným kódem.. v tom kódu není nic jiného než souřadnice bodů odkud kam má jezdit a s jakou rychlostí.. nic víc v tom není...
když máš čtverec máš to pouhé 4 body a dá se to napsat ručně bez problémů,protože máš pouze 2 hodnoty Zka, pokud tam máš obecnou křivku s několika sty body tak v každém bodě bude Zko o jiné souřadnici a je na někom aby ty souřadnice dopočítal.. většinou to dělá nějaký CAM . a ten CAM neudělá zase nic jiného než přepíše sled souřadnic XYZ, XYZ, XYZ.. odkud kam bude jezdit a to Zko půjde plynule nahoru.. a opakuju že je pak jedno jesli to pošleš do machu nebo do emc v tom problém není.. tohle pro takové množství bodů už ale nelze napsat ručně (protože by se z toho počítání člověk zbláznil..) takže se nauč v CAMu ..
věčný rýpal,který musí mít poslední slovo, odpůrce low-cost zařízení končících v naprosté většině případů v hromadě šrotu
uživatelé hýbátek, kteří mají z mých příspěvků celoživotní trauma nechť si mé příspěvky VYPNOU
Uživatelský avatar
robokop
Site Admin
Příspěvky: 22954
Registrován: 10. 7. 2006, 12:12
Bydliště: Praha
Kontaktovat uživatele:

8. 11. 2014, 11:17

jestli chces aby stroj nekam dojel musis zadat souradnici toho bodu
Vsechna prava na chyby vyhrazena (E)
prochaska
Sponzor fora
Příspěvky: 8349
Registrován: 16. 7. 2006, 12:33
Bydliště: Praha Bohnice + Roudnice nad Labem
Kontaktovat uživatele:

8. 11. 2014, 11:54

takze mi to s toho vypliva ze ked to chcem tak urobit ako to chcem aby slo tak za kazdy xy suradnicu musim dopisat rucne Z vzdy o nieco väcsie a pri navrete stale o nieco mensie ?
Ano, pokud se chceš pohybovat spojitě v X,Y i Z současně, pak musíš psát souřadnice X, Y i Z. Proč to před tím jelo "šikmo nahoru" nevím, ale v tomhle kódu to naprogramované není, díval jsem se na to NC editorem :-)
Aleš Procháska
Odpovědět

Zpět na „LinuxCNC - drive pod nazvem EMC2“